Well, technically there is a difference. Fizzy water in Europe (Perrier, San Pelligrino, etc.) is quite different to regular carbonated water (which is what you get out of the soda button).
 
I may be ignorant of the difference between soda water and sparkling water. Actually, I am, so I just had to Google it - lol! Apparently "sparkling water" is carbonated mineral water, and "soda water" is carbonated "regular" water. I have always asked for soda water in the dining room. Quite often the server doesn't know how to get it (some have said they'd order it from the bar for a fee). Just tell them it is one of the options on the soda machine in the kitchen, and no charge (just like the colas from that machine for dinner). The head server has always been familiar with this, and as always the servers have always been great about finding out about it.
